What Does “Christ The Lord is Risen!” Mean?


“Christ The Lord is Risen!”  means:

● We don't have to fear death

● We have the power to overcome everything 

● We always have access to the holy spirit 

● We always have reason to rejoice 


Christ The Lord is Risen Means We Don’t Have To Fear Death.

No one really enjoys thinking about dying, but it’s obviously a reality we’ll all face someday. When Jesus rose, he broke the power of death for all who follow him. There are only two destinations for the soul when we pass on…Heaven or Hell. Romans 8:11 says “And if the Spirit of him who raised Jesus from the dead is living in you, he who raised Christ from the dead will also give life to your mortal bodies because of his Spirit who lives in you.” Jesus died so we never have to face Hell. His resurrection proved He was able to remove sin and its penalty. If He remained dead the opposite would be true – that believers are still in sin. And the unavoidable end of a sinful life is death.


Christ The Lord is Risen Means We Have The Power To Overcome Everything.

When Jesus rose from the dead after three days, he didn’t just overcome death. He overcame the enemy’s power over us. From the moment Jesus’ eyes opened on that first glorious Easter morning, the power of sin became completely null for all that follow him. We now have the upper hand against the enemy and his plans to steal, kill and destroy. Christ’s resurrection enables our victory over addiction, fear, anxiety, love of self, people pleasing, really everything that separates us from God’s love, and becoming our best self. We don’t have to succumb to any of it.


Christ The Lord is Risen Means We Always Have Access To The Holy Spirt.

Before Jesus died, we did not have direct access to God the father, and we did not possess the Holy Spirit within us. In John 14:27 Jesus told his disciples “I am leaving you with a gift—peace of mind and heart. And the peace I give is a gift the world cannot give. So don’t be troubled or afraid.” The gift of the Holy Spirit only came through Jesus’ death and resurrection. He is our great comforter, friend and guide in life. Aside from the gift of eternal life, the Holy Spirit is one of the greatest treasures ever bestowed upon human kind.


Christ The Lord is Risen Means We Always Have Reason To Rejoice.

Every Christian has a reason to rejoice daily because Jesus lives. This life is a shadowed fraction of what life will be like in Heaven. Thanks to Him, this is just the beginning. Jesus’ selfless obedience and love for us drove him to voluntarily endure unthinkable torture, pain and fear. When we’re feeling defeated, depressed, alone, etc. it helps to remember how valued and loved we are…to the point of Jesus’ self sacrifice. When he rose, he gave us a new, abundant, liberated life. Nothing can separate us from the love of God, because of the resurrection. That is enough to rejoice, even from the trenches.


Easter Sunday is one of the most celebratory days of the year, for those who are born again in Christ. We all walked out of the grave with him that day. We all have reason to shout that, “Christ The Lord is Risen!”
